The Phenom's Wife: How a Caregiver Lost and Found Herself in Her Family's Trauma by Miller, Jenna Ann

The unsparingly truthful journal of a wife and mother catapulted into a life of hope, wonder, and devotion, while her husband lies nearly lifeless in a coma.

After Jenna's husband Steve suffers a traumatic brain injury from a cycling accident, she emerges into a mystical, optimistic existence. For 388 consecutive days Jenna posts stories of gratitude and miraculous healing on her CaringBridge blog.

While this is a story of loss, hope and growth, Jenna describes fascinating details of a medical recovery from coma. She admits the agony of parenting through trauma and recounts the trials of negotiating health insurance and healthcare. By chronicling her exhausting life as a caregiver, Jenna recognizes and shares the process of becoming someone new.
